十进制与二进制在速度上的对比需结合应用场景分析,结论如下:
结论:二进制在计算机运算中速度更快,但十进制在某些特定场景下具有优势。
一、二进制运算速度优势
硬件基础匹配 计算机内部由逻辑门电路组成,仅支持二进制(0和1),直接映射硬件操作,无需转换,因此运算效率更高。
位操作高效
二进制便于实现位运算(如与、或、位移等),这些操作是计算机底层处理的核心,速度显著优于十进制。
存储与传输优化
二进制数据占用存储空间更小(每个比特仅需1位),且网络传输中错误检测更简单,进一步提升了整体效率。
二、十进制在特定场景的优势
人类可读性
十进制更直观易懂,便于程序员编写和调试代码,尤其在复杂算法中,十进制表达更简洁。
部分计算优化
对于浮点运算或并行计算,十进制技术可能更高效,但需依赖硬件支持(如专用浮点单元)。
三、适用场景总结
二进制: 适用于底层硬件运算、位操作及存储效率要求高的场景(如嵌入式系统、高性能计算)。 十进制
注意:实际应用中,计算机内部始终以二进制处理数据,十进制仅作为人类与硬件之间的桥梁。讨论“速度”时,需明确是底层运算还是应用层处理。